hu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L数据库扩展的艺术与实践|MySQL数据库扩展名,MySQL数据库扩展

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文主要探讨了MySQL数据库扩展的艺术与实践。在Linux操作系统下,MySQL数据库的扩展名可以实现对数据库的扩展和优化。通过使用MySQL数据库扩展名,可以实现对数据库的备份、恢复、安全性管理等功能。还可以通过MySQL数据库扩展名来实现对数据库的性能监控和分析,以便更好地优化数据库的性能。本文将详细介绍MySQL数据库扩展名的使用方法及其在实际应用中的实践经验。

本文目录导读:

  1. MySQL数据库扩展的必要性
  2. MySQL数据库扩展的策略
  3. MySQL数据库扩展的实践

在当今数字化时代,数据已经成为企业的重要资产,对于许多企业来说,MySQL数据库因其开源、成本效益高、易于使用和维护等优点,已成为首选的数据库解决方案,随着业务的发展,数据量的激增,如何对MySQL数据库进行有效的扩展以满足不断增长的数据需求,成为许多IT团队面临的挑战。

MySQL数据库扩展的必要性

MySQL作为个关系型数据库,在满足中小型企业的数据存储和处理需求方面表现出色,当数据量达到一定规模,单一的服务器资源将面临瓶颈,表现为查询速度变慢、并发处理能力下降等,为了保证数据库性能,满足业务发展的需求,对MySQL进行扩展就显得尤为重要。

MySQL数据库扩展的策略

1、硬件升级

硬件升级是最直接的扩展方式,包括增加服务器的CPU、内存、硬盘等资源,这种方法能够在一定程度上提高数据库的处理能力,但受限于物理硬件的潜能,升级空间有限。

2、数据库分区

数据库分区是将一个大表分成多个小表,每个小表存储在不同的数据库中,分区可以提高查询效率,减少单表的数据量,从而提高数据库性能,但分区管理较为复杂,需要考虑分区策略、分区键的选择等因素。

3、读写分离

读写分离是将数据库的读操作和写操作分开,分别由不同的服务器承担,通过引入读写分离,可以有效减轻单台服务器的压力,提高数据库的并发处理能力,实现读写分离可以使用主从复制等技术。

4、集群部署

集群部署是将多台服务器组成一个数据库集群,共同对外提供服务,在集群中,可以通过负载均衡技术分配请求,实现数据库的横向扩展,MySQL集群可以使用Galera等技术实现。

5、分布式数据库

分布式数据库是将数据分布在多台服务器上,通过分布式技术实现数据的统一管理和查询,分布式数据库可以充分利用多台服务器的资源,提高数据库的处理能力,常见的分布式数据库解决方案有MyCat、ProxySQL等。

MySQL数据库扩展的实践

在进行MySQL数据库扩展时,需要遵循以下实践原则:

1、合理规划硬件资源,确保服务器性能稳定。

2、选择合适的分区策略,降低单表数据量。

3、逐步实施读写分离,提高数据库并发能力。

4、根据业务需求选择合适的集群和分布式解决方案。

5、定期对数据库进行性能监控和调优,确保数据库稳定运行。

MySQL数据库扩展是确保数据库性能和业务发展的关键,通过合理的选择和实施扩展策略,可以有效提高数据库的处理能力,满足企业不断增长的数据需求,数据库扩展并非一蹴而就,需要IT团队根据实际情况,逐步优化和改进,实现数据库的可持续发展。

相关关键词:

MySQL, 数据库扩展, 硬件升级, 数据库分区, 读写分离, 集群部署, 分布式数据库, 性能监控, 数据库优化.

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

MySQL数据库扩展:mysql数据库扩容有几种方法

原文链接:,转发请注明来源!